      @bobjonkman btw key to USB audio interfaces are finding ones that are "class compliant" in terms of GNU/Linux compatibility. The Focusrite ones tend to be class compliant (I have a Focusrite Scarlett 2i2 for gigs), and I have a larger Firewire Presonus Firepod (in my home studio)
